7.6.1 RC1 panic "coVarsOfTcCo:Bind"

Ganesh Sittampalam ganesh at earth.li
Wed Aug 22 07:31:43 CEST 2012


I'm getting the panic below when building darcs 2.8 with GHC 7.6. It'll
take some effort to cut it down or give repro instructions for an
uncut-down version (I needed to hack a lot of underlying packages to be
able to even get as far as doing this build), so could someone confirm
that it's worth it before I do so? I can't spot anything already
reporting this in trac.



ghc.exe: panic! (the 'impossible' happened)
  (GHC version for i386-unknown-mingw32):
    cobox{v a6Czs} [lid]
      = cobox{v a6CTr} [lid] `cast`
(<main:Darcs.Test.Patch.WithState.WithState{tc r1LL8}
                                        model{tv tC} [tv]
(main:Darcs.Witnesses.Ordered.FL{tc r1Dy1} prim{tv ty} [tv]
main:Darcs.Witnesses.Ordered.:>{tc r1Dyc}
main:Darcs.Witnesses.Ordered.FL{tc r1Dy1}
prim{tv ty} [tv])>
                                     ghc-prim:GHC.Types.~{(w) tc 31Q}
main:Darcs.Test.Patch.WithState.WithState{tc r1LL8}
(Sym cobox{v a6CSH} [lid])
<main:Darcs.Witnesses.Ordered.FL{tc r1Dy1}
prim{tv ty} [tv]
main:Darcs.Witnesses.Ordered.:>{tc r1Dyc} main:Darcs.Witnesses.Order
ed.FL{tc r1Dy1}
prim{tv ty} [tv]>)

Please report this as a GHC bug:  http://www.haskell.org/ghc/reportabug

